Franklin Graham Spreads The Good News Of Christ To Thousands As 'God Loves You' Tour Traverses The Country

Last week, thousands of people braved the elements to attend Franklin Graham's 'God Loves You' tour, which has been making its way across the United States. Despite the inclement weather, approximately 9,000 individuals gathered at the latest stop in Elkton, Maryland, to hear the conservative Christian leader's message of hope and salvation.

Graham tweeted, "It’s cloudy, but the rain has stopped here in Elkton, MD, for the God Loves You Tidewater Tour at the Fair Hill Fairgrounds—and it’s great to see lots of people coming in! There’s still time to make it if you’re in the area!"
 
As CBN previously reported, Graham also tweeted, "I shared a message from the Word of God. There’s a lot of bad news today, but the Good News is that God sent His Son, Jesus Christ, to earth on a rescue mission to save us from our sins so that we can be forgiven & spend eternity with Him."
